Etching is a chemical process that involves selectively removing material from a metal surface. Stainless steel etching, in particular, utilizes acid or chemical solutions to create intricate designs and patterns on the material’s surface. This technique is commonly used for decorative purposes, branding, and labeling. Additionally, it allows for precise markings and can be utilized to incorporate serial numbers, logos, or other identification marks on stainless steel components.

The stainless steel etching process is a multi-step procedure. It all starts with the selection of the appropriate grade of stainless steel, as the composition can significantly impact the etching results. Once the stainless steel sheet or component is chosen, it undergoes cleaning and preparation. This involves thorough degreasing and removal of any surface contaminants, as they can impact the etching quality.

The next step involves the application of a resist material onto the stainless steel surface. The resist acts as a protective mask that prevents the acid or chemical solution from contacting areas where the design or pattern is not desired. The resist material can be either a photoresist film or a durable material, such as wax or adhesive vinyl. The chosen resist material is applied uniformly and then allowed to dry.

After the resist material is sufficiently dry, the stainless steel sheet is exposed to an etchant solution. The etchant’s composition and concentration depend on the desired etching depth and the type of stainless steel being etched. Commonly used etchants include ferric chloride, nitric acid, and hydrochloric acid. The etching time is carefully controlled to achieve the desired depth while maintaining consistency and quality.

Once the desired depth is achieved, the stainless steel sheet is thoroughly rinsed to remove any residual etchant. The resist material is then removed, revealing the intricate design or pattern etched onto the surface. This can be done through peeling, submerging the sheet in a solvent, or using a high-pressure spray wash. Care must be taken during this step to ensure that the etched design is not damaged or altered.

The stainless steel etching process offers numerous benefits and finds applications in various industries. Firstly, it provides an aesthetically pleasing finish, enhancing stainless steel’s visual appeal. The etched designs can be intricate, precise, and customizable, allowing for unique branding or personalization options. Stainless steel etching is often utilized in architectural applications, jewelry making, and decorative panels.

Moreover, the etched designs are permanent and resistant to wear, as they become an integral part of the stainless steel surface. This durability makes stainless steel etching an ideal choice for items subjected to frequent handling or exposure to harsh environmental conditions. Additionally, the etching process does not alter the stainless steel’s inherent properties, ensuring that its corrosion resistance and strength remain unaffected.
